Well some vaal gems are outright amazing. Vaal spark is a must for any crit spellcasting build. Link it with trap + lmp + added lightning and you can clear huge sections of a map 3-5 times per map.
Vaal immortal call/molten shell/cyclone/siphon(especially this one) are all very strong. Other vaal gems like rain of arrows are pretty lackluster and need at least more damage added to them or more CC(make the rooting effect last at least 10 seconds). |

From personal experience, Vaal Frost Nova is indeed very good at clearing stronboxes. Use it as soon as the box is opened and mine (which is only linked to an Added Chaos) kills everything that isn't a rare or an exile (and sometimes it'll even kill those).
With the right build, Vaal Burning Arrow seems like it'd be rather good with LMP + Added Fire + Increased AoE attached to it. The soul count is short enough that you could use it on a semi-regular basis. Last edited by werezompire#4977 on Mar 11, 2014, 12:06:40 PM

" Vaal siphon/spark/immortal call/cyclone are easily worth the cost and will dramatically increase your clearing time(or survivability with ic). Premaps in merciless they kind of suck due to inferior mob density but in maps you get to use them several times. Vaal spark specifically can easily destroy bosses with one cast. I haven't looked for all vaal gems yet so I'm not sure how many "great" ones there are. I agree many are hugely inferior like groundslam/doublestrike/rain of arrows.
